What is the Goethe Certificate A2?

The Goethe Certificate B2 Certificate A2 is a language proficiency certificate issued by the Goethe-Institut, a German cultural organization that promotes the German language and culture worldwide. The certificate is created for individuals who have a fundamental understanding of the German language and wish to demonstrate their capability to communicate in daily situations. The A2 level is the 2nd level of the six-level efficiency scale defined by the Common European Framework of Reference for Goethe Certificate C1 Languages (CEFR).

What does the Goethe Certificate A2 exam entail?

The Goethe Certificate A2 exam is a standardized test that assesses an individual's language skills in 4 locations:

  1. Reading comprehension: Candidates are needed to check out and understand numerous texts, such as signs, posters, and brief articles.
  2. Listening comprehension: Candidates listen to audio recordings and respond to concerns to demonstrate their capability to understand spoken German.
  3. Writing: Candidates are required to compose short texts, such as postcards, emails, or letters.
  4. Speaking: Candidates participate in a conversation with an inspector to demonstrate their capability to interact efficiently in German.

Preparation for the Goethe Certificate A2 exam

To prepare for the exam, individuals can:

  • Take a course: Enroll in a German language course at a language school or online platform.
  • Use study materials: Utilize books, workbooks, and online resources particularly created for the A2 level.
  • Practice with native speakers: Engage in discussions with native German speakers to enhance speaking and listening abilities.
  • Take practice exams: Familiarize yourself with the exam format and content by taking practice exams.
